The LFSR algorithm, used for generating random TLB indexes for TLBWR instruction, was inclined to produce a degenerate sequence in some cases. For example, for 16-entry TLB size and Wired=1, it gives: 15, 6, 7, 2, 7, 2, 7, 2, 7, 2, 7, 2, 7, 2, 7, 2, 7, 2, 7, 2, 7, 2, 7, 2, 7, 2, 7, 2... When replaced with LCG algorithm from ISO/IEC 9899 standard, the sequence looks much better, with about the same computational effort needed.
